Improve Code Quality: The certificate focuses on best practices in software development, such as modular design, meaningful naming conventions, and effective commenting. These skills help professionals write cleaner, more efficient, and easier-to-maintain code, which can reduce bugs and improve software performance and reliability.
Foster Team Collaboration: Clean coding practices promote clearer communication among team members. The certificate teaches how to write code that is easy to understand and modify, which enhances teamwork and reduces the risk of misunderstandings. This collaborative environment can lead to more efficient development processes and better project outcomes.
